Q: Is 280,142,747 a Prime Number?
A: No, 280,142,747 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 280142747 can be evenly divided by 1 2,549 109,903 and 280,142,747, with no remainder.
Since 280,142,747 cannot be divided by just 1 and 280,142,747, it is not a prime number.
